De Bortoli Windy Peak Pinot Grigio 2012 (King Valley, Vic)
12%, Screwcap, $14

From De Bortoli’s King Valley range. Right in the zone too.

Very bright and clear bright bottle. Still translucent to pour, even though its 2 years old – impressive. Water white fruit pebbly aromatics, a tint of peach through the palate and a dip of sweetness to finish.

Clever representation of Pinot Grigio in the lighter commercial shade. Not extraordinary, but does very well for rather few dollars.

Source: Sample
Tasted: January 2014
Drink: 2014
Score: 16.5/20, 88/100
Would I buy it? Not quite. Drinkable though.
